The St. Bernard Urban Rapid Transit (SBURT) strives to provide timely, efficient, reliable and safe public transportation to the citizens of St. Bernard Parish. SBURT also provides Parish Assisted Evacuations during emergencies.


Rider Information

SBURT's route offers frequent trips between Arabi and Poydras for only $1. Service on the route operates Monday through Friday. Passengers may board at any designated bus stop.

Route Deviations

On-Demand Route Deviations:

Passengers may request a deviation to any location that SBURT buses can legally traverse in the following seven areas during normal business hours: St. Bernard Hospital, Trist Middle School, J. F. Gauthier School, St. Bernard State Park, and Fanz Trailer Park. Due to road conditions, route deviations are not guaranteed and may be cancelled with little or no notice.

Pre-Arranged Route Deviations to specific addresses:

Passengers may request 24 hours in advance a route deviation to and from a location three/quarters of a mile off the fixed route within the jurisdiction of St. Bernard Parish so long it is determined that the transit vehicle is able to safely access the pick up and drop off locations. The request for a deviation must be made to the St. Bernard Transit via phone (504-277-1907) or email transit@sbpg.net at least 24 hours prior to the pick up and drop off. Cause must be provided to passengers if it is determined that their request is not feasible.

Elderly (60 Years and older), Disabled (E/D), & Medicare passengers

Elderly (60 Years and older), Disabled (E/D), and Medicare passengers may receive a 50% discount on fares. In order to receive the reduced fare, passengers must display a Medicare card with picture ID, or E/D Identification card. For more information, contact the SBURT office at 504-277-1907.

Rules & Regulations

  • Fares Are $1 
  • No Weekend or Holiday Service 
  • Scheduled Times Are Approximate 
  • Alternate Routes Are Used During Adverse Traffic Conditions 
  • No Eating or Drinking Allowed on SBURT Buses
